After Japan began its full-scale invasion of China on July 7, 1937, Soong Mei-ling fully supported the anti-Japanese patriotic action led by her husband Chiang Kai-shek, and her work was also expanded from the air force to wartime diplomacy and the rescue of orphans.
On March 10, 1938, the Wartime Child Care Association was established in Hankou, with Song Meiling as its chairman. During the War of Resistance Against Japanese Aggression, the Children's Care Association set up more than 20 branches and 53 wartime childcare homes throughout the country to accommodate more than 30,000 refugee children. Song Meiling often brings candy and biscuits to the nursery to visit the children. In March and April 1938 alone, Song Meiling paid for the living expenses of nearly 2,500 refugee children.

From February to April 1943, Song Meiling visited the United States as Chiang Kai-shek's special envoy. Song Meiling has successively given speeches and given interviews to reporters in the US Congress, New York, Chicago, Los Angeles, and other places, and has carried out intensive diplomatic activities, setting off a "whirlwind of Song Meiling" in the United States, making the United States and even the world look at China with astonishment.
The most notable was Song Meiling's speech to the U.S. Congress on February 18, 1943. Before the formal speech, the US side invited her to "say a few words" to the Senate, and Song Meiling gave an impromptu speech in the Senate without preparation. On the first day after her speech, Soong attended a White House press conference with President Roosevelt and his wife. A reporter asked Song Meiling: I heard that China has not made full use of manpower? Song Meiling replied: "China has done its best in manpower, but there is a shortage of munitions, and China has no shortage of well-trained pilots, but not enough aircraft and gasoline."
A reporter immediately asked: How does China get arms? Song Meiling replied: "The president has solved many important problems, and I agree with your president on this issue." President Roosevelt immediately said that the U.S. government would speed up aid to China. So the reporter turned the conversation to Song Meiling and asked her what she thought of military assistance. Song Meiling replied, "Heaven help the self-helpers."
The progress of the US aid to China is exactly as Song Meiling hoped. Before Song Meiling went to the United States, 53 transport aircraft on the China-India route carried less than 1,500 tons per month. On March 10, after Soong Mei-ling's speech to the U.S. Congress, Roosevelt telephoned Chiang Kai-shek to approve the creation of the Fourteenth Air Force, with Chennault as commander, and to increase the number of Chennault aircraft to 500 as soon as possible; In addition, the number of aircraft carried by Hump airlift will be increased, with the ultimate goal of reaching 10,000 tons of supplies per month. In fact, in the first half of 1944, the US Air Force aided China more than 500 aircraft, and in the second half of the year, the supplies coming to China through the Hump route exceeded 46, 600 tons per month. Song Meiling's trip to the United States completely changed the stereotype of Americans about China, and more than 250,000 people listened to her speeches, from Luce, the founder and president of Time magazine, down to ordinary housewives, workers and other Americans from all walks of life, who donated money to China. Tens of millions of dollars were donated from the American people alone, giving strong support to the Chinese people who persisted in the war under the most difficult conditions.
When Song Meiling visited the United States this time, the Chinese americans also deeply benefited. The US Congress seized the opportunity to repeal the More Than 60-year-old Chinese Exclusion Act, so that Chinese Americans were no longer discriminated against and their social status was significantly improved.
